My treatment methods

Acceptance and commitment (ACT)

I use ACT in conjunction with other modalities to suit the client’s needs. The core concepts are cognitive defusion, acceptance, and awareness of the present moment.

Cognitive Behavioral (CBT)

I use CBT to treat anxiety disorders, OCD, depression, and personality disorders. Furthermore, CBT is the first line of treatment for insomnia (CBT-I). CBT is so valuable, as it teaches us to to detach from our thoughts and evaluate them. I have found CBT to be very effective and successful.

Daialectical Behavior (DBT)

I have incorporated some fundamentals of DBT when working with those who may struggle with emotional regulation and impulsivity.

Exposure Response Prevention (ERP)

I use ERP when working with those who struggle with OCD, specific phobias, and social anxiety disorder. I have found it to be very effective.

Positive Psychology

Positive Psychology focuses on the client’s strengths. This modality includes interventions and exercises designed to enhance well-being. These exercises include gratitude journals and mindfulness practices.
